Overview"As successful CEOs devote their time and energy to growing their companies in a fast-paced world of global trade, high technology and fierce competition, the how of business-also known as organizational culture-can be neglected. The repercussions include losing your most talented people, damaging your reputation, and wreaking havoc on company growth. Through the use of real-life examples and client conversations, organizational psychologist and Master Coach Dr. Shahrzad Nooravi shares three models for driving a strong culture: WATCH IT (examining your culture from a fresh perspective), DRIVE IT(R) (a coaching model) and WALK IT(R) (a senior team alignment model).
